Calvin D. Jackson Mr. Jackson is a Forensic Science Consultant and a former Supervisory Special Agency with the Air Force Office of Special Investigations. He also served as Commander of a large Field Investigative Office, Chief of Forensics, and Chief of Foreign Intelligence Services. He was a Forensics Consultant to London's New Scotland Yard, guest lecturer at England's Oxfordshire Police Training Center, and the United Kingdom's Bram's Hill Police Staff College. He was featured guest on Sacramento City College's "Forensics, Circumstances of Death," and Adjunct Instructor for the Sacramento Public Safety Center. He is currently a Crime Scenes Technology Instructor. He received his Masters in Forensic Science from The George Washington University, a Fellowship in Forensic Medicine from the Armed Forces Institute of Pathology and is a Fellow in the American Academy of Forensic Sciences. |
